Transaction 61b43784d48b4616c522e3e6e51d210d505e33aa662bed24c2a402e2636378a5
1 Input
1 Output
-
61b43784d48b4616c522e3e6e51d210d505e33aa662bed24c2a402e2636378a5:0
- value
- 2661088
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e50ff32f0a9aac71e941d37dba88845df563900a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MtAr9iE2Zp531pJstqBK7PDfNMAUUtjT7